PRESIDENT Ferdinand R. Marcos, Jr. will have to pursue reforms for good governance to substantiate his campaign slogan of unity and pull off support towards economic recovery, according to political analysts and economists.
It would allow Mr. Marcos to tackle long-term challenges with the help of a broad array of sectors, they said.
John Paolo R. Rivera, an economist at the Asian Institute of Management, said a good governance agenda that values human rights is “good for the economy because everyone is given the opportunity to contribute to national productivity.” It said that the rule of law and public service delivery are among the links between good governance and human rights.
